  • It's like Toilet Paper all over again (tube shortage 2022?!)

    My buddy sent me a youtube link tonight, I'm sure some of you have seen it... standard youtube sensationalist clickbait stuff, but also true regarding the inability to get tubes due to the Russia Ukraine thing.

    His video reminded me to check the shopping cart I was building up on my supplier's website. I had a few months stock waiting for me to hit "submit". Reloaded it, everything was out of stock. Ouch...

    It's interesting.. even if there wasn't a shortage, there is now. To add fuel to the fire, I hastily bought a bunch of overpriced 6L6's because youtube convinced me that the future will be without tubes and music..

        I would think any tube shortages at the moment are more due to the supply chain issues that have been happening than to the actual Ukraine thing, probably a literal boatload of tubes sitting in shipping containers offshore with everything else.It will get worse, depending on what happens in Russia going forward.
